Secret Stairs, Lifts And Much More - The Fascinating Life Inside A Wind Turbine

We all look at them and wonder what's going on inside! Well, this morning Dermot & Dave got to the bottom of just how a wind turbine works in Ask Me Anything. As of 2020 the Republic of Ireland has 3700 megawatt of installed wind power nameplate capacity. In 2015 wind turbines generated 23% of Ireland's average electricity demand, one of the highest wind power penetration in the world. Ireland's 250 wind farms  are almost exclusively onshore, with only the 25 MW Arklow Bank Wind Park situated offshore as of 2020. But, what is life like inside the turbines? Well some of the smaller ones have ladders that will bring engineers all the way to the top, while the bigger turbines - which can be seen in the Midlands - have a small lift, which can take those who to work on the them right to the top.
